(Philadelphia, PA) — Chartwell Law announced today that founding partner Charles (Chuck) Barreras has been named the firm’s first Managing Partner. The appointment marks an important step in Chartwell’s continued growth as the firm is poised to surpass 300 attorneys who represent clients in more than 30 offices across the country.
“Chuck has been a guiding force at Chartwell since day one,” said Dana Bennett, Chartwell’s Chief Administrative Officer. “As we take this next step in our evolution, there is no one better suited to help lead us into the future and to keep us connected to our cultural roots. His leadership and vision have shaped the firm’s success from the beginning, and his collaborative approach will help Chartwell continue its remarkable people-focused approach to growth.”
The is a natural progression from Barreras’s role as Chartwell’s spokesperson over the past two years, where he helped articulate the firm’s vision and direction both internally and externally. In his new role, Barreras will focus on promoting and supporting initiatives targeted at maintaining firm culture, strategic planning, lateral recruiting and integration, and supporting the legal and business operations of the firm.
Barreras has played a central role in Chartwell’s journey from a four-lawyer workers’ compensation boutique in Pennsylvania to a nationally recognized litigation firm representing clients across the United States. His practice focused on general liability, premises liability, workers’ compensation, insurance coverage, and employment law on behalf of domestic and London-based insurance carriers. He has successfully managed all aspects of litigation, including strategy development, investigation supervision, and trial defense in both state and federal courts. Barreras has also served on Chartwell’s Administrative Committee (AdCom)—since that body was created nearly 20 years ago—to help guide and direct the future of the firm.
In addition to his leadership at Chartwell, Barreras served honorably for 14 years in the United States Army Reserve, attaining the rank of Captain before entering the Individual Ready Reserve. Prior to graduating from law school, he also gained experience in claims investigation and adjusting. His unique perspective, drawn from both the insurance and legal sides of the industry, has made him a trusted counselor to clients for more than 30 years.
“Chartwell was founded on the belief that there was a better way to serve clients and build a law firm,” Barreras said. “More than 20 years later, I’m proud of what we’ve built together and honored to take on this role as we continue to grow and innovate.”
Barreras’s leadership comes at a pivotal moment for Chartwell, which has expanded rapidly in recent years. With offices now spanning more than 20 states and a national reputation in areas such as insurance defense, insurance coverage, transportation, workers’ compensation, and commercial litigation, Chartwell is poised to continue its trajectory as one of the fastest-growing firms in the country.
